Assume that you are a retail customer.Use the information below to answer the following question.
 Bid  Ask  Borrowing  Lending S0($/)$1.42=1.00$1.45=1.00 i$ 4.25%APR4%APRF360($/ϵ)$1.48=1.00$1.50=1.00 i€ 3.10%APR3%APR\begin{array} { r c c c c c } & \text { Bid }& \text { Ask }& \text { Borrowing } &\text { Lending }\\S _ { 0 } ( \$ / € ) & \$ 1.42 = € 1.00 & \$ 1.45 = € 1.00 &\text { i\$ } 4.25 \% \mathrm { APR } & 4 \% \mathrm { APR } \\F _ { 360 } ( \$ / \epsilon ) & \$ 1.48 = € 1.00 & \$ 1.50 = € 1.00 & \text { i€ } 3.10 \% \mathrm { APR } & 3 \% \mathrm { APR }\end{array} If you borrowed $1,000,000 for one year,how much money would you owe at maturity?


Definitions:

Parietal Cortex

A part of the parietal lobe involved in processing sensory information relating to touch, spatial orientation, and navigation.

Tectopulvinar System

Projections from the retina to the superior colliculus to the pulvinar (thalamus) to the parietal and temporal visual areas.

Visual Pathway

The network of neurons and structures involved in processing visual information from the retina to the visual cortex and other parts of the brain.

Striate Cortex

Primary visual cortex (V1) in the occipital lobe; shows stripes (striations) on staining.
